The DKX 3.0 Iso twin-shaft batch mixer ensures the highly homogeneous mixing required by Trisoplast.
Increased Capacity with Unchanged Mobility
The centerpiece of the new system, from Nisbau GmbH, is the DKX 3.0 Iso. During development, the focus was on achieving a significant increase in performance while maintaining the same level of flexibility.
Sustainability and Mixing Quality
High operational reliability, process engineering consulting, and service capabilities for international operations are key decision-making criteria. The fundamental technological principle remains the proven twin-shaft mixing system, which guarantees the highly homogeneous mixture required for Trisoplast through intense shear action and turbulent mixing processes.
